  • Patent number: 6581793
    Abstract: A cap adapted to be secured on a neck of a container wherein the cap includes a top wall and a depending annular skirt having an inner annular projection. A fluid seal having a central transverse wall, an outer annular shoulder and a inner annular bead rests on the inner annular projection so as to define a space between the cap and the fluid seal into which the fluid seal is pushed when the cap is secured to the neck of the container to make a seal between the outer annular shoulder of the seal and the inner annular projection.

  • Patent number: 6415966
    Abstract: A push-pull closure which includes a base for securing to a container and which base includes an upper plug which seats within an opening in a valve lifter which is moveable with respect thereto between a closed position and an open position and wherein a cap is provided for covering the valve lifter when in a closed position. A tamper indicating seal is applied over a portion of the top of the valve lifter and the plug of the base in order to provide a seal therebetween and to provide evidence of tampering or of first opening of the valve lifter from the closed position to the open position.

  • Patent number: 6050452
    Abstract: A push-pull type closure includes a collar with an internal thread, a button associated with the collar, and a cap covering the button before the closure is first open, the cap including a tamper-proofing strip which is non-releasably confined in a groove of the collar, the transverse section of the tamper-proofing strip having a profile in the shape of a U which is open at the top, and the annular strip including an extreme portion which becomes lodged in the hollow of the U during crimping.

  • Patent number: 5779075
    Abstract: The invention relates to a screw cap made of a plastics material, the cap comprising a closing portion (3); optional sealing means (7) mounted in or integral with the closing portion (3); and a tamper-proofing ring (8) made in one piece with the closing portion (3). According to the invention, the cap comprises a breakable zone (17) of the outer portion (9) enabling it to be opened on unscrewing the cap (1) leads firstly to an empty space (18) between the outer portion (9) and the skirt (5), which empty space (18) is delimited downstream, with respect to the unscrewing direction of the cap (1), by at least one non-breakable fastening (19) which does not break on unscrewing the cap (1), and which is part of said link means (11), and secondly to a breakable zone (20a), to a cut (20b), or to a gap (20c) in the inner portion (10) so that, on unscrewing the cap (1), the tamper-proofing ring (8) remains associated with the closing portion (3).

  • Patent number: 5397009
    Abstract: A screw-type closure device comprising a safety cap having a guarantee strip which includes a first ring connected to the bottom of a cap skirt by connecting bridges and a second ring assembled on the first ring by a peripheral zone of reduced thickness which allows the second ring to turn up inside the first ring. The second ring may be divided into at least two independent segments which are separated by gaps. The first ring of the guarantee strip includes at least one oblique groove of reduced thickness opposite one of the gaps in the second ring and which is torn to severe the guarantee strip from the container when the cap is removed.
